Caremark Doncaster, Bassetlaw and West Lindsey is a home care agency that provides care for adults in Doncaster and the surrounding areas including Armthorpe, Tickhill, Conisbrough
and Hatfield.
All staff employed by Caremark Doncaster, Bassetlaw and West Lindsey are vetted and highly trained. They are only selected once they have been fully referenced and DBS checked and are fully trained before being placed with clients on a permanent basis.

Inspection ratings
We rate most services according to how safe, effective, caring, responsive and well-led they are, using four levels:
- Outstanding - The service is performing exceptionally well.
- Good - The service is performing well and meeting our expectations.
- Requires Improvement - The service isn't performing as well as it should and we have told the service how it must improve.
- Inadequate - The service is performing badly and we've taken action against the person or organisation that runs it.
- Not rated - we have not yet rated this area of the service, this is normally because the assessments we have carried out have been focused on other key questions.
